Women’s Rights –
CEDAW Regional Events

February 2026

IWN is partnering with The Women’s Resource Centre to host a regional event to hear directly from women and women’s organisations about the challenges you face and the changes you want to see. Your input will help shape the UK’s shadow report to the UN Committee on the Elimination of Discrimination against Women (CEDAW) as part of the upcoming List of Issues reporting round.

 

CEDAW is the key international treaty that holds governments to account on women’s equality and rights. This is a crucial opportunity to make sure the realities of women’s lives across the UK are heard at the highest level.

 

WRC is the leading coordinator of a grassroots, women's sector response to the CEDAW Committee. We have previously been commended on our role in uniting the sector and speaking with one voice on the issues that will affect us all the most. This is even more relevant now, when the reporting process has been streamlined and the Committee want a short list of top-line issues to take to the government.  

 

At this event, we will:

  • Share an accessible explainer of the CEDAW process and why it matters.

  • Create space for women to share experiences on key issues such as violence against women and girls, economic inequality, health, welfare reform, the family courts and political participation.

  • Collect practical evidence and recommendations that will feed into the UK civil society report to the UN.

  • Build connections between local women’s organisations and strengthen our collective voice.

 

Who should attend?

Women with lived experience, grassroots women’s groups, frontline women’s services, and allies who want to influence policy change at both national and international levels.

 

Why it matters?

By taking part, you’ll be contributing to holding the UK Government accountable for its obligations under international human rights law and ensuring that women’s voices are central to shaping the future of policy and practice.
